Target Information

Advantage Partners, Inc. (referred to as "AP") has entered into a share transfer agreement with the shareholders of Epoch Japan, Inc. (referred to as "Epoch") and has acquired shares of Epoch as of November 30, 2015. Founded in 2000, Epoch is a funeral service company that has established a firm foothold in the industry as a pioneer of family funerals under the brand name "Famille," which means "family" in French. With the mission of revitalizing Japan through family funerals, Epoch operates 46 dedicated ceremonial halls in Miyazaki, Kumamoto, Chiba, Kanagawa, and Hokkaido, offering a unique service model by conducting "one group per day" ceremonies. Additionally, they provide high-quality funeral services through partnered ceremonial halls primarily in the Kanto region.

Industry Overview in Japan

The funeral services industry in Japan has seen a significant transformation in recent years driven by changing societal norms and the increasing demand for personalized ceremonies. Long-standing traditions are evolving, and families are increasingly seeking more personalized and intimate funeral experiences as opposed to larger, more traditional services. This shift in demand is reinforcing the growth of companies like Epoch, which specialize in family-oriented ceremonies.

Moreover, Japan's aging population is contributing to a rise in demand for funeral services. As the demographic trends indicate a growing number of elderly individuals, the need for comprehensive funeral services continues to expand. Companies that can adapt to meet changing consumer preferences will have a competitive edge in the market.

Environmental and economic concerns are also emerging trends within the industry. Consumers are becoming more environmentally conscious, seeking eco-friendly options for funerals and memorialization, further pushing companies towards innovation in service offerings.

Overall, the Japanese funeral services industry is positioned for growth as it adapts to the needs of modern consumers while maintaining respect for traditional practices.

The Rationale Behind the Deal

AP recognizes the robust business foundation that Epoch has built over the years. The acquisition aims to leverage Epoch's established reputation and operational expertise to further strengthen its market position. By providing support in enhancing management strategies and brand development, AP intends to foster Epoch's continued growth in the competitive funeral services landscape.
